=== Admissions ===
Franklin and Marshall's admissions process is rated as "more selective" by U.S. News & World Report. The acceptance rate for the Class of 2028 was 26%.
== Campus ==
Franklin & Marshall is situated in Lancaster, a historic city with deep Pennsylvania Dutch and German-American roots. Located in the northwest corner of the city, the college's campus primarily spans Lancaster City and parts of Manheim Township. The overall architectural design of F&M can be traced through a blend of Gothic Revival, Federal Revival, and modernist influences, reflecting the evolution of the institution over nearly two centuries. Franklin & Marshall College’s Old Main, Goethean Hall, and Diagnothian Hall are listed on the National Register of Historic Places for their Gothic Revival architecture and historical significance as the core of the college's 19th-century campus.
